Photograph of Samuel Benfiled Steele on horseback facing three men also on horseback and identified as, left to right, Captain Berry, Captain Ryan, and Captain Le Blanc, taken at Grimston Gardens, Folkestone, England, ca. 1916. Descriptive text on verso written by Harwood Steele.
Photographer's stamp on verso.
